The true stress (σ),truestrain(ϵ) diagram of a strain hardening material is shown in figure. First, there is loading up to point A, i.e, up to stress of 500 MPa and strain of 0.5. then from point A, there is unloading up to point B, i.e, to stress of 100 MPa, given that the young's modulus E = 200 GPa, the natural strain at point B (ϵB) (correct to two decimal places).


Open in App
Solution

We know that

Slope of AB line is E

E = ACBC

200×103MPa=(500100)MPaBC

BC = 400200×103=0.002

ϵE=0.50.002=0.498
